



The hotel is entirely built from honey-coloured wood and expansive windows mean you scarcely feel separated from the forest. Celajes Restaurant serves traditional Costa Rican and Monteverde-inspired dishes, which you'll enjoy over views of the ocean. In between meals, grab a smoothie at the juice bar, snack on Costarican tapas and enjoy one of their 'garden-to-glass' cocktails. In your down time, visit the lakeside Beer Garden for a taste of the in-house spring ales, or head to the spa for a massage and soak in the exclusive-use, glass-walled Jacuzzi.
Constructed from beautiful, rich wood, the rooms range in location, luxury and views (up to 270°!). The rooms in the main building have a view of the Nicoya Peninsula, while the more private chalet rooms have forest, mountain or ocean vistas. Each room has a private patio, floor-to-ceiling windows and high-quality linens, and as they move up the scale, you'll find private Jacuzzis for two. The suites boast hanging daybeds, spa-style bathrooms and the very best views at Belmar. For eco-friendly reasons, there is no TV or air-con - just how we like it.
Take a walkabout through the organic garden (and pick ingredients to make your own cocktail) or enjoy a horseback tour of the family farm. Explore the stunning Savia reserve, where your guide will share the intricacies of this unique eco-system as you wander across hanging bridges and trails and look for the nearly 400 bird species that reside in Monteverde, including 30 hummingbirds. The hotel will pack a delicious picnic for you to enjoy too. The, visit after nightfall to experience completely different sounds and sights, including sunset from the treetops.
